The children on the hill is the story of 2 children who live with their psychiatrist Grandmother after losing their parents. Their lives are unusual in the sense they are home schooled with above average intelligence learning the ways of the world through the assignments from the grandmother and having very little to do with the real world. They have a club, the monster club. The story really takes a twist when their grandmother brings home one of the children from her work, a place called the Inn. A place for people with mental health issues and a criminal background. A place that is like a halfway house with Gran at the helm. The child who doesn't talk and doesn't remember anything is integrated into their family as a sibling.... It's up to Vi to keep an eye on her.

The book follows 2 time periods and excerpts from a book which tells us a little of the in-between time. 13 year old Vi is our narrator for the past and Lizzy in 2019.
